< 返回
自建直播点播云服务器
2025-11-10 03:20
作者:必安云
阅读量:4
自建直播点播云服务器的可行方案与实际应用
在数字化内容消费持续增长的当下,直播与点播成为企业或个人打造专属内容平台的核心需求。自建直播点播云服务器不仅能规避商业平台限制,更可实现数据掌控与个性化功能开发。本文详细拆解自建方案的关键逻辑与实践路径,为不同技术背景人群提供参考。
一、为何选择自建而非云服务
灵活性与成本控制
云服务商的封闭生态常与业务需求产生冲突。例如某电商直播平台初期采用第三方服务时受制于套餐限制,当需接入AI客服时无法扩展视频流数据分析功能。自建系统则可根据业务规模动态调整服务器架构,通过本地化部署降低长期成本。统计显示,随着并发量超过500路直播,自建cdn分发系统的边际成本较第三方方案下降37%。
数据主权与安全需求
医疗、教育等特殊行业的视频内容涉及敏感信息。某在线教育机构在教室监控系统中部署自建服务器,结合VOD点播功能后,既满足了实时督导需求,又通过本地存储规避了数据外流风险。对比云服务方案,自建系统能实现更严格的访问控制,支持私有协议的端到端加密传输。
技术适配性突破
健身教学平台需要将运动轨迹图层叠加到直播画面中,这一需求需自定义RTMP推流协议实现。商业云服务商通常仅提供SDK接口,无法开源协议层代码,而自建架构可在Nginx编译阶段集成定制模块,完整实现图形水印与动作识别功能。
二、技术选型与架构设计
核心组件选型策略
- 流媒体传输协议:采用SRT替代传统RTMP协议,通过强化的传输稳定性应对弱网环境,某地方电视台在5G直播车应用中证实SRT能将断流率从12%降至0.3%
- 视频存储方案:分布式存储系统如MinIO,支持对象存储与文件存储混合架构。数据显示分布式设计可使视频检索速度提升83%,单节点故障率降至0.01%以下
- 编码加速技术:利用NVIDIA GPU的NVENC实现硬件转码,某4K直播项目验证显示硬件转码可节省70%的CPU资源,成本降低40%
系统架构分层设计
- 推流接入层:使用Icecast2搭建RESTful接口,支持不同编码格式适配
- 分发调度层:部署基于GeoDNS的智能CDN,某体育赛事平台通过此方案使异地观看延迟缩短至200ms内
- 用户交互层:采用WebRTC技术实现低时延互动,测试表明该协议将实时弹幕传输延迟控制在150ms水平
计算资源规划
- 推流计算单元:建议单节点配备16核CPU与NVidia T4显卡,支持12路1080p直播流接收
- 存储节点:采用RAID10配置HDD与SSD混合存储池,某案例中SSD承担热数据90%的IOPS,HDD完成冷数据归档
- 分发边缘节点:根据用户地理分布,规划3-5个二层节点,有效降低全国用户访问延迟
三、关键部署流程详解
硬件准备看详解
- 实时转码服务器:配置AMD EPYC 7742处理器+4张T4显卡,支撑每台服务器20路实时转码能力
- 存储服务器:采用分布式文件系统,每节点配置12块20TB硬盘,通过纠删码技术实现99.999%数据可靠性
- 传输优化设备:部署局域网交换机7600bps/MHz的背板带宽,保证核心层数据跑动能力
软件配置步骤
- 安装FFmpeg单机处理环境,通过
apt-get install libv4l-dev满足虚拟摄像头驱动依赖
- 部署Gstreamer实时视频处理框架,某案例验证该工具在广告插播场景中可实现<200ms的无缝切换
- 配置自签名SSL证书,包含
openssl req -new -x509 -days 365 -nodes -out cert.pem -keyout cert.pem等核心命令
测试与优化
- 实时性测试:使用iperf3进行4K流连续12小时测试,某次实测显示丢包率稳定在0.2%以内
- 延迟优化:通过设置RTCP间隔为500ms,某平台将直播总延迟从1.8秒压缩至0.4秒
- 权限验证:设计三级鉴权体系,分别为源站身份认证、时态授权码验证、设备指纹核验
四、常见问题解决方案
直播延迟过高的处理
- 优化NTP同步精度至0.1ms以内
- 在docker容器中调整内核参数
net.ipv4.tcp_no_metrics_save=1
- 使用Intel QAT技术加速H.265编码,某流媒体机房实测QPS提升85%
兼容性痛点突破
- 实现协议桥接器,支持RTSPL/SRT/RTMP的实时转换
- 开发媒体分析微服务,可自动检测过期编码格式并提示替代方案
- 为老旧iOS设备配置HLS转码沙箱,某项目中适配率从68%升至97%
大规模并发预案
- 采用边缘缓存策略,将热门视频缓存路径预写入磁盘
- DNS解析预量产:在工信部备案时规划BGP多线IP分发
- 验证熔断机制:当单节点负载超过75%自动切换备用推流路径
五、未来技术趋势前瞻
边缘计算深度融合
随着5G网络覆盖提升,将推流采集设备与边缘服务器一体化部署成为新方向。某物流培训系统已在分拣现场安装算力盒子,实现无网络依赖的自主流媒体合成。
AI赋能的智能调度
机器学习模型开始应用于码率选择。某省级电视频道通过分析用户带宽曲线,实现了广告直播中自适应5-10Mbps动态码率调整,用户体验评分提升22%。
区块链存证技术
为规避版权纠纷,某知识付费平台在直播流中内嵌区块链哈希值,结合存储节点签名系统,使内容权属验证过程完全不可篡改。
对于追求技术主权与业务扩展性的组织,自建直播点播云服务器并非单纯的技术选择,而是确定了"有的放矢"的发展模式。通过合理规划软硬件资源,把握协议层与算法的适配性,能够构建出兼顾性能、成本与创新的数字媒体基础设施。